Rejoti Publishing & Productions publishes books, poetry, newsletters, and chapbook anthologies under its literary wing. The organization also offers performing and theater workshops that are open to the public. Rejoti was founded in 1983 by Veona and Reggie Thomas, and is currently run by Veona Thomas.
This private music school in a quiet residential area offers one-on-one instruction in voice, violin, piano, flute and oboe. The students include many professional performers from the New York metropolitan area.
Owner Jeanne Donato, a former concert violinist, and voice trainer Joan DeCaro comprise the faculty. The two women have also published a book on voice technique entitled, The Way to Sing: Secrets of Bel Canto. Donato explains that the book is based on techniques developed by a renowned voice teacher, the late Ugo DeCaro, and asserts that it is the rare person who can't learn to improve their singing voice with the help of this book.
